Industry Forecast
Global Satellite Data Services Industry is projected to be valued at USD 21.54 Billion by 2025, registering
a CAGR of 19.4% from 2019 to 2025. 
Factors such as the increasing number of private firms in the space
industry and significant advancements in geospatial imagery analytics are
driving the growth of the Industry. Furthermore, the increasing demand for
small satellites for earth observation across the globe is projected to aid the
growth of the Industry.

Growth Opportunities in the Industry
Image data segment
accounted for the larger Industry share in 2018: The image data
segment is also expected to exhibit higher CAGR during the forecast period.
This growth can be attributed to the increasing use of satellite image data for
monitoring crops, flooding, icebergs, and coastal traffic.
Environmental monitoring
segment is expected to be the fastest-growing: The environmental
monitoring segment is expected to exhibit the highest CAGR during the review
period. The increasing use of satellite data for meteorology and the prevention
of illegal fishing and tree felling is driving the growth of the segment.
